How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Education from Viterbo Cost?

$29,350 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Viterbo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Viterbo paid an average of $845 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$28,660$28,660
Fees$690$690
Books and Supplies$1,000$1,000
On Campus Room and Board$9,670$9,670
On Campus Other Expenses$2,500$2,500

Viterbo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Education

22 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
77.3% Women
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 22 students received their bachelor’s degree in education.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Of the students who received their bachelor’s degree in education in 2019-2020, 77.3% of them were women. This is less than the nationwide number of 81.9%.

undefined

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

None of the education bachelor’s degree recipients at Viterbo in 2019-2020 were awarded to racial-ethnic minorities*.
